Asia Cup final 2023: India crowned champions for record-extending eighth time

IND vs SL, Asia Cup final 2023: After winning the toss, Sri Lanka found themselves in an embarrassing situation losing their first six wickets for 12 runs

India raced to the 51-run target in 6.1 overs with Shubman Gill (27 not out) and Ishan Kishan (23 not out) in the middle (Pic: @bcci/X)

Mohammed Siraj conjured a magical spell of seam and swing bowling with magnificent figures of 6 for 21 as India crushed Sri Lanka by 10 wickets to win the Asia Cup final 2023 after a gap of five years.

This was India's eighth Asia Cup title and also their biggest victory (263 balls) in ODIs in terms of balls remaining.
